Bahama Breeze comes off Darden’s menu

About this episode

Darden (DRI) decides to pull the plug on the Bahama Breeze chain. (00:14)AMD slides even as Q4 results, guidance surge past Wall Street estimates. (01:13) Walmart (WMT) reaches $1 trillion market value. (02:33)
